‘No Regrets’ Barcelona Sporting Director Deco Breaks Silence On Xavi Hernandez’s Exit

international media news
February 15, 2025 180 Views0

Deco the sporting director of Barca said that he does not regret Xavi’s exit who was the former manager of Barca. Xavi announced his exit back in January 2024, but by April, President Laporta made him reverse his decision and stay. Then, just three weeks later, Barca decided to let him go. The club got a lot of heat for this quick change and mixed messages about Xavi. People were upset at how this all played out, more so after Xavi thanked Laporta and Deco for their trust. Despite the mess, Deco sticks by the choice.

Deco Reflects On Xavi’s Exit But Stands By Decision

Deco, the Barcelona Sporting Director, said it was hard to let Xavi Hernandez go, but he believed it was the right choice. In an interview with the Sport he stated that “Xavi’s departure was not easy because he had won a league, he had entered the club at a difficult time and accepted the challenge, but last season was tough in every sense and that is why we decided that the best thing was a replacement on the bench.” Even after the controversy that took place, Deco still remained the same and said that “I don’t regret anything because I’m always direct and honest. Xavi will always be a friend and an important person in the history of Barca.”

Deco Clarifies Xavi’s Departure And Their Complicated History

Deco said that Xavi was the one to leave and he was not forced by the club to leave by the club. While explaing he stated that “We have a lot of affection for him, but football is football. Sometimes things don’t work out the way you think and you have to change. And we can’t forget that the first one to take the step of leaving was Xavi, and then he changed his mind, and that whole drama ensued.” Their past has been rocky since they played for Frank Rijkaard. Xavi is said to have wanted Deco gone when Pep Guardiola came. They did not agree much when they were coach and sport boss either.
